Subject: [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H 4/4] aacdec_usac: skip coeff decoding if the number to be decoded is 0
Date: Thu,  6 Jun 2024 07:12:35 +0200
Message-ID: <20240606051243.3177266-4-dev@lynne.ee>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20240606051243.3177266-1-dev@lynne.ee>

Yet another thing not mentioned in the spec.
---
 libavcodec/aac/aacdec_usac.c | 8 +++++++-
 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/libavcodec/aac/aacdec_usac.c b/libavcodec/aac/aacdec_usac.c
index 97655787ee..5dd489a43b 100644
--- a/libavcodec/aac/aacdec_usac.c
+++ b/libavcodec/aac/aacdec_usac.c
@@ -572,9 +572,15 @@ static int decode_spectrum_and_dequant_ac(AACDecContext *s, float coef[1024],
     int gb_count;
     GetBitContext gb2;
 
-    ff_aac_ac_init(&ac, gb);
     c = ff_aac_ac_map_process(state, reset, N);
 
+    if (!len) {
+        ff_aac_ac_finish(state, 0, N);
+        return 0;
+    }
+
+    ff_aac_ac_init(&ac, gb);
+
     /* Backup reader for rolling back by 14 bits at the end */
     gb2 = *gb;
     gb_count = get_bits_count(&gb2);
